Shop Sells 'Eu' Beef Ears From Turkey: 'Should Be Banned'
Summary by Omroep Brabant
1 Articles
1 Articles
Pet store Zooplus sells dried beef ears from various brands and claims they originate from the European Union (EU). However, this is not true, according to research by Omroep Brabant. Animal rights organization Animal Rights is concerned. The dried beef ears in question are often given to dog owners as a snack.
